Signs Your Control Arm Bushings Need Attention
Experiencing vague steering, knocking sounds over bumps, or uneven tire wear? These are classic symptoms of bad control arm bushings, critical rubber or polyurethane components that absorb road shock and allow suspension movement.
- Vague or loose steering feel.
- Clunking or rattling noises from suspension.
- Uneven tire wear patterns.
- Vehicle pulling to one side.
Your vehicle's control arms connect the chassis to the steering knuckle, and the bushings at their pivot points are essential for a smooth, controlled ride. When these bushings degrade, they lose their ability to dampen vibrations and maintain proper alignment, leading directly to the symptoms you'll feel and hear.
The primary role of control arm bushings is to provide a flexible pivot point while absorbing impact and vibration. When they fail, this cushioning effect is lost, and metal-on-metal contact can occur, or the suspension geometry becomes unstable. This is particularly noticeable when you first start driving or encounter uneven road surfaces.
Common Manifestations of Bushing Wear
A distinct knocking or clunking sound, especially when turning the wheel or driving over imperfections like potholes or speed bumps, is often the first audible cue. This noise typically originates from the front suspension area.
You might also notice your vehicle drifting or pulling to one side, even on a flat road. This indicates that the suspension geometry is compromised because the worn bushings are no longer holding the control arm in its precise operating position.
The sensation of vague or loose steering is another significant symptom. You may feel like you have less direct control over the vehicle, requiring constant small corrections to maintain a straight path. This makes driving feel less responsive and more taxing, especially on longer journeys.
The inability to hold a straight line is a critical indicator of bushing failure.
Another consequence is uneven tire wear. Without properly functioning bushings, the tire alignment can shift dynamically, causing premature or abnormal wear on the tire edges or the tread itself. This compromises tire lifespan and can affect handling.

From Causes to Corrections: Restoring Your Suspension
What causes control arm bushings to fail, and what's the fix? These components are subjected to constant stress from road impacts, weather exposure, and the natural flex of the suspension system. Over time, this leads to degradation.
Root Causes of Bushing Deterioration
The most common culprit is age and mileage. Rubber bushings degrade due to exposure to heat, road salts, moisture, and the constant flexing they endure. This natural wear can accelerate significantly due to poor road conditions or aggressive driving habits.
Impact damage from hitting potholes or curbs can also cause premature failure. A severe jolt can split, tear, or dislodge a bushing, compromising its integrity instantly.

Exposure to corrosive elements like road salt, oil, and fuel can also break down the rubber or polyurethane material, leading to cracking and disintegration. Effective Solutions for Worn Bushings
Replacing worn control arm bushings is the definitive solution. This is typically done as part of a control arm assembly replacement, though in some cases, only the bushings themselves can be pressed out and replaced.
The process involves lifting the vehicle, removing the wheel, and then unbolting the control arm. Depending on the vehicle, this might require specialized tools like a press to remove old bushings and install new ones, or replacement of the entire control arm unit if the bushings are integrated or heavily damaged.
This is a job that requires mechanical skill and appropriate safety precautions. For many, it’s a task best left to a professional mechanic to ensure correct alignment and reassembly.

Preventing Future Control Arm Bushing Problems
Can you prevent control arm bushings from failing prematurely? While wear is inevitable, proactive maintenance and mindful driving can significantly extend their lifespan.
Proactive Maintenance and Driving Habits
Regular inspections are your first line of defense. During oil changes or tire rotations, take a moment to visually check the bushings for any signs of cracking, tearing, or excessive deformation. Catching minor issues early can prevent them from escalating.
Avoid aggressive driving. Speeding over potholes, taking corners at excessive speeds, or frequently driving on rough terrain puts immense strain on your suspension components, including the control arm bushings. A smoother driving style prolongs their life.
Keep your vehicle clean, especially in areas prone to rust and corrosion. Washing away road salt, grime, and other contaminants can help prevent material breakdown. When replacing tires, ask your mechanic to inspect the condition of your control arm bushings. They are often in a position to spot early signs of wear that might otherwise be missed during a quick visual check.
Choosing quality replacement parts is also important. If your bushings or control arms (like the Mazda 3 lower control arm or F-150 lower control arm) need replacement, opt for reputable brands or OEM parts. Cheap, low-quality components may fail much sooner.
